#5d0114 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5d0114 is composed of 36.5% red, 0.4% green and 7.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 98.9% magenta, 78.5% yellow and 63.5% black. It has a hue angle of 347.6 degrees, a saturation of 97.9% and a lightness of 18.4%. #5d0114 color hex could be obtained by blending #ba0228 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660000.

● #5d0114 color description : Very dark red.
#5d0114 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5d0114 has RGB values of R:93, G:1, B:20 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.99, Y:0.78, K:0.64. Its decimal value is 6095124.

Shades and Tints of #5d0114
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0003 is the darkest color, while #fffbf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#5d0114
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#322c2d is the less saturated color, while #5d0114 is the most saturated one.
